  • How is the weather in Las Bocas?

    Las Bocas has a hot desert climate. The summer months, from June to September, can reach temperatures above 100°F (38°C). The winter months, from November to February, are much cooler, with temperatures ranging from 50°F to 75°F (10°C to 24°C).

  • What are some of the best things to do in Las Bocas?

    Visitors to Las Bocas often enjoy exploring the local beaches, engaging in water sports such as swimming and snorkeling, taking leisurely boat rides, and relishing local Mexican cuisine at the town's numerous eateries.

  • What is the best time of year to visit Las Bocas?

    The most frequented time to visit Las Bocas is during the winter months, from November to February. This period offers relatively pleasant weather, ideal for beach activities. The local community also organizes a traditional fair in February, which adds to the festive atmosphere.

  • What are some hiking trails in Las Bocas?

    While Las Bocas itself is not known for its hiking trails, the Sierra de Alamos, located approximately 85 miles (137 km) away, is a popular spot for outdoor enthusiasts, with a multitude of trails surrounded by diverse flora and fauna.

  • What are some family activities to do in Las Bocas?

    Families in Las Bocas often enjoy beach activities, including building sandcastles, picnicking, and swimming. Boat rides to observe marine life are also popular. Additionally, exploring local markets can provide a cultural learning experience for the whole family.

  • What are some of the best day trip ideas in Las Bocas?

    A day trip to the bustling city of Hermosillo, around 109 miles (175 km) away, is often recommended. Visitors can explore the Cathedral of the Assumption, the Sonora Desert Museum, and the ecological park, Parque La Sauceda. Another great day trip idea could be a visit to the coastal city of Guaymas, featuring vibrant local markets, waterfront promenades, and the landmark Delfinario Sonora, where visitors can learn about marine life conservation.
